针对有限元方法求解自由板温度应力存在计算模型复杂、工作量大等问题,以混凝土热传导方程为基础,推导出自由板温度场有限差分格式,并在温度场求解基础上,利用广义虎克定律和自由板特性,推导出自由板温度应力差分公式,并通过实例对自由板温度和应力进行求解。结果表明,差分算法求解自由板温度和应力场与有限元求解结果一致,且效率较高。
